Safiral Letovice

Project idea

The basic design concept is based on the functional operation of a production hall and an administrative building. The structure consists of two interconnected volumes in the form of rectangular blocks. The administrative section is designed as a narrow, taller block, while the production hall takes the shape of a low, flat block. The volumes are set into slightly sloping terrain, allowing the second floor of the administrative building to connect directly to the roof of the production hall, which can be used as a usable outdoor space. During the design process, I focused on the layout of interior spaces based on their function and logical spatial relationships. I divided the building into functional zones: on the eastern side of the administrative building's ground floor are staff facilities, while the western side contains technical areas. The second floor is used for office spaces. The cladding materials were selected according to the client’s request—to visually express the purpose of the production on the façade. Since the company produces printed circuit boards, I chose perforated metal panels for the administrative façade, referencing the appearance of their products. The façade of the production hall is clad with HPL (High-Pressure Laminate) panels. To ensure sufficient natural lighting, I incorporated large windows, which are also present in the production hall.

Project description

The administrative building is divided into zones for the public, employees, and technical facilities. The production hall is organized into a production area, receiving, dispatch, and a paint shop. The main entrance to the building is located on the south side of the administrative part, on the ground floor. From the entrance hall with a reception/security desk, both employees and visitors enter the building through separate cloakrooms. On the eastern side of the ground floor, there is a shared canteen for all employees with service facilities, restrooms for the public and staff (including barrier-free access), a showroom for product presentation, and a large meeting room. The technical facilities are located on the western side of the floor. Access to both the second floor and the production hall is provided via staircases or an elevator. The second floor contains offices and the entrance to the green roof. Production employees have their own changing rooms with sanitary facilities, through which they enter the production hall. The hall itself is designed as an open space with a separate paint shop and storage areas for receiving and shipping.

Technical information

The primary structural system of the administrative building is based on a reinforced concrete skeletal framework, which provides a robust and durable support for the entire structure. Similarly, the production hall employs the same reinforced concrete frame system, ensuring consistency in structural performance and load distribution across both buildings. The floor slabs are constructed using reinforced concrete panels, offering excellent rigidity and the ability to span large areas without intermediate supports. This contributes to the creation of open and flexible interior spaces suited to various functional requirements. The partition walls that divide the individual rooms are made from concrete masonry units, with thicknesses of either 250 mm or 150 mm, chosen based on spatial and acoustic needs. The materials selected for the building’s exterior and interior finishes include: Glass, used extensively to enhance natural lighting and visual connectivity; Perforated metal panels, which serve both aesthetic and functional roles on the façade, allowing ventilation and visual interest; Exposed concrete, providing a raw, durable surface that emphasizes the building’s structural character; HPL (High-Pressure Laminate) panels, chosen for their durability, ease of maintenance, and clean appearance; Sandwich panels, used mainly for cladding technical areas, offering good thermal insulation and quick installation. This combination of materials balances functionality, aesthetic appeal, and structural efficiency, contributing to a cohesive architectural expression.
